Where to Use Caution: Avoiding Visual Clutter
While versatile, this asset is not a one-size-fits-all solution. As a designer, I advise using it carefully in certain contexts. The intricate detail of the rhinestones can become lost or appear messy if scaled down too much for mobile graphics with dense information. It is not suitable for formal corporate branding where minimalism and strict neutrality are required. Additionally, avoid placing these letters on busy, patterned backgrounds. The complexity of the rhinestone texture needs negative space to breathe. If the background competes with the foreground, you lose the professional appearance you are aiming for.
For text-heavy ads or long-form editorial layouts, use these letters sparingly as accents rather than body text. Their primary strength is in headlines, hero graphics, and decorative brand elements. Overuse can dilute their impact and make the overall design feel chaotic rather than curated.
Practical Designer Notes for Implementation
To get the most out of this creative design, I recommend a few practical steps before launching your campaign. First, test the SVG with your existing brand color palette. While the default may be silver or gold, adjusting the hue to match your brand colors can create a more cohesive look. Check how it performs in black and white to ensure it retains its shape and impact without relying solely on the "sparkle" effect.
- Mockup Testing: Place the letters inside real campaign mockups. See how they look on a t-shirt, a mug, or a phone screen. Digital previews can be deceiving.
- Font Pairing: Experiment with pairing these varsity letters with other typefaces. They often work well alongside clean sans serif fonts for contrast, or elegant script fonts for a mixed-media aesthetic. Avoid pairing them with other display fonts that compete for attention.
- Licensing Verification: Always confirm the commercial license terms before using any design assets in paid campaigns or client work. Ensure your usage aligns with the creator's permissions, especially if you are selling physical products featuring the design.
- Spacing and Balance: Review the kerning and spacing when combining letters. Varsity fonts can sometimes feel bulky, so adjusting the tracking can improve readability and visual balance.
